您的位置 首页 知识

unix系统和linux系统的区别(unix与linux的区别)

Unix系统和Linux系统是两种常见的操作系统,它们之间有许多区别。本文将从系统的背景、基本特点、源代码和许可证等方面对Unix系统和Linux系统进行比较,以帮助读者更好地理解它们之间的差异。

Unix系统诞生于1960年代末至1970年代初,是第一个真正的多用户、多任务操作系统。它的设计目标是提供一个稳定、可靠和安全的操作环境。而Linux系统则诞生于1991年,是由芬兰学生Linus Torvalds开发的。它是一个自由和开放源代码的操作系统,构建在Unix的基础上,通过不断的社区参与和发展,成为了一个功能强大且广泛使用的操作系统。

在基本特点方面,Unix系统和Linux系统有一些相似之处,比如都支持多用户、多任务和多线程,都提供了强大的网络功能。它们都具有良好的稳定性和安全性,可以在高负载的环境下运行。而Linux系统在可定制性上更加灵活,用户可以根据自己的需求选择和定制各种组件和功能,使其能够适应不同的应用场景。

另一个区别是它们的源代码和许可证。Unix系统的源代码是闭源的,只有少数厂商可以访问和修改。而Linux系统基于GNU通用公共许可证(GPL),源代码是开放的,任何人都可以自由获取、使用和修改。这种开放源代码的特性使得Linux系统得到了广大开发者和用户的支持,也推动了整个开源社区的发展。

Unix系统更多地被用于商业领域,比如大型服务器、超级计算机和科学研究中心等。而Linux系统更广泛地应用于个人电脑、移动设备和嵌入式系统等领域。它不仅具有较低的成本,还拥有丰富的应用程序和工具,可以满足不同用户的需求。

Unix系统和Linux系统虽然有一些相似之处,但它们之间仍然存在许多区别。从系统的背景、基本特点、源代码和许可证等方面可以看出,Linux系统在可定制性和开放性上具有更大的优势。这也是为什么Linux系统能够蓬勃发展、得到广泛应用的原因之一。无论是选择Unix系统还是Linux系统,我们都可以根据自己的需求和实际情况做出最佳的选择。